I try to avoid jumping into most of these "controversy" threads on this
reflector, but feel I must support Tom on this one.  I think his point is
that to ask for assistance from the reflector community to verify a qso is
not in keeping with the spirit of Top Band.  It's like the List operations,
so prevalent on higher bands, which, as if by gentlemen's agreement, have
been mostly non-existent on 160.  

I also do not see how Tom's comments can in any way be taken as critical of
the VK9 ops.  The point seems to be if one has any doubt about whether they
worked someone, they should at least annotate their log as such.
Personally, it would not stop me from submitting the contact for credit, if
I needed the country, as long as I was reasonably sure I had worked them.
But I wouldn't solicit assistance from anyone to see if it was a "good one."
Just my preference.

I was not one of the fortunates to work Lord Howe on 160, but congratulate
all those who did, including Glenn, who most probably deserves it.  But
Tom's point is valid; we have to have our own internal ethics, or Top Band
isn't Tops anymore.
